怎么写php答辩
-
PHP答辩
一、简介
PHP(Hypertext Preprocessor)是一种广泛使用的开源脚本语言,特别适用于Web开发,可以嵌入HTML中使用。它的语法类似于C语言,但更易学习和使用。本文将从PHP的基本语法、优点、应用领域和未来发展等方面进行分析和讨论。二、PHP的基本语法
2.1 变量和常量
PHP使用$符号标识变量,变量名区分大小写。常量使用define()函数定义,一旦定义后不可更改。2.2 数据类型
PHP支持多种数据类型,包括整型、浮点型、字符串、数组、布尔型等。在使用变量前不需要预先声明其类型。2.3 运算符
PHP支持常见的数学运算符和逻辑运算符,并且还具有一些特殊的运算符和函数供字符串处理和数组处理使用。2.4 流程控制
PHP支持常见的条件语句、循环语句和跳转语句,使程序能够实现不同的逻辑控制。三、PHP的优点
3.1 易于学习和使用
PHP的语法类似于C语言,对于有过编程经验的开发人员相对容易上手。同时,PHP还提供了丰富的文档和广泛的社区支持,使初学者能够快速入门。3.2 跨平台性
PHP可以运行在多种操作系统上,包括Windows、Unix和Linux等。这使得开发人员能够轻松在不同的平台上进行开发和部署。3.3 强大的Web开发能力
PHP的主要应用领域是Web开发,它能够处理HTTP请求和响应,生成动态的网页内容。PHP还支持与数据库的交互,使得开发人员能够构建强大的Web应用程序。四、PHP的应用领域
4.1 网站开发
PHP可以用来构建各种类型的网站,包括个人博客、电子商务网站、社交媒体平台等。它提供了一系列的函数和工具,使开发人员能够轻松处理用户请求和生成动态的内容。4.2 Web应用程序开发
PHP不仅可以开发静态网站,还可以用来构建复杂的Web应用程序。它可以与数据库进行交互,处理用户输入和输出,实现各种业务逻辑。4.3 系统管理
PHP还可以用作系统管理工具,通过执行系统命令和访问系统资源,实现对服务器和应用的监控和管理。五、PHP的未来发展
随着Web技术的不断演进和互联网的快速发展,PHP作为一种强大的Web开发语言将继续发展壮大。未来,PHP将更加注重性能和安全性,并提供更丰富的扩展库和工具,以满足不断变化的需求。结论:
PHP作为一种广泛使用的脚本语言,具有易学易用、跨平台等优点,在网站开发、Web应用程序开发和系统管理等领域有着广泛的应用。而且,随着互联网的发展,PHP的前景仍然十分广阔。因此,学好PHP对于Web开发人员来说是非常重要的。2年前 -
PHP的答辩主要围绕PHP语言的特点、用途、优势、缺点及发展趋势等方面展开。以下是一个可能的答辩写作结构:
一、引言
在引言部分,可以简要介绍PHP语言的发展历程、使用范围以及其在Web开发中的重要性。二、特点
1. 动态性:PHP是一种动态类型的语言,不需要事先定义变量的类型,灵活性较高,对程序员来说使用起来较为方便。
2. 易学易用:PHP语法简单明了,有着类似于C语言的语法结构,让初学者容易上手。
3. 跨平台性:PHP可在各种操作系统上运行,如Windows、Linux、MacOS等,同时也支持各种Web服务器,如Apache、nginx等。
4. 开源性:PHP是开源的,可以通过PHP的源代码进行修改和定制,也可以使用大量的开源库、框架和工具来提高开发效率。
5. 天然与Web的集成:PHP最初就是为Web开发而设计的,它内置了针对Web开发的很多库和函数,使得编写动态网页和Web应用变得简单快捷。三、用途
1. 网站开发:PHP可以作为服务器端脚本语言,用于构建动态网站,生成HTML页面,并与数据库进行交互。
2. Web应用开发:借助框架如Laravel、Symfony等,PHP可以快速构建各种Web应用,包括电子商务、社交网络、博客平台等。
3. 命令行工具:PHP不仅可以用于Web开发,还可以开发命令行工具,如数据处理、文件操作等。
4. 游戏开发:虽然PHP并非专门用于游戏开发的语言,但它可以通过扩展、库和框架来实现游戏的后端逻辑处理。
5. 数据处理:PHP有很多内置函数和扩展,使得处理、分析和操作大量数据变得高效简便。四、优势
1. 社区活跃:PHP拥有庞大而活跃的开发者社区,提供丰富的教程、文档和技术支持,有助于开发者们相互学习和共同成长。
2. 高效快速:PHP的语法简单且可读性强,同时具有高度的执行效率,使得开发人员可以快速构建高性能的Web应用。
3. 大量工具和框架:在PHP的生态系统中,有众多的工具和框架可以供开发人员使用,例如Composer、PHPUnit、CodeIgniter等,加速开发进程。
4. 数据库兼容性:PHP支持各种常见的数据库,如MySQL、PostgreSQL、Oracle等,开发者可以方便地与数据库进行交互。
5. 安全性:PHP有很多内置的安全性特性和函数,可以有效地防范SQL注入、跨站脚本攻击等常见的Web安全威胁。五、缺点
1. 扩展依赖:PHP在一些高级功能和性能优化方面可能需要依赖扩展模块,引入了一定的复杂性和额外的配置工作。
2. 代码管理:PHP项目相对于其他编程语言可能更缺乏规范和结构。如果项目变得复杂,可能容易出现代码混乱和难以维护的问题。
3. 性能瓶颈:由于PHP是一种解释性语言,在处理大规模并发请求或高并发负载情况下,其性能可能会有瓶颈表现。
4. 安全风险:PHP的开放性和灵活性,在开发过程中容易引入安全隐患,如未过滤的用户输入可能导致安全漏洞。六、发展趋势
1. PHP7的普及:PHP7在性能和资源利用方面带来了显著改进,逐渐取代了PHP5成为主流版本,未来的发展将更加集中在PHP7的基础上。
2. 前后端分离:随着前后端分离的趋势,PHP作为后端语言将与JavaScript等前端技术进行更加紧密和深入的结合。
3. 扩展与生态系统发展:PHP的扩展和生态系统将持续扩展和完善,为开发者提供更多的解决方案和开发工具,提高开发效率。
4. 云计算和容器化:PHP将在云计算和容器化的背景下发展,更多的应用将迁移到云平台上,使用容器技术进行部署和管理。
5. 特定领域的应用:PHP在一些特定领域,如人工智能、大数据、物联网等方面的应用也将得到拓展和发展。七、结论
通过本次答辩,我们可以看出PHP是一种功能强大、易学易用、应用广泛的语言。它在Web开发中有着广泛的应用,同时也有不断发展的潜力。在以后的学习和工作中,我们应继续深入学习和掌握PHP,不断拓展自己的技能,为Web开发做出更大的贡献。2年前 -
标题:PHP答辩写作指南
一、引言
在本文中,将详细讲解如何写好PHP答辩。文章将从方法、操作流程等方面进行阐述,帮助读者了解如何撰写一篇高质量的PHP答辩文章。二、方法
1. 理解题目:仔细阅读答辩题目,明确答辩任务和要求。
2. 收集资料:通过查阅相关资料,获取与题目相关的理论知识和实践经验。
3. 制定策略:根据收集到的资料,制定答辩的总体结构和逻辑框架。
4. 确定重点:在文章中确定重点内容,突出论证中最重要的部分。
5. 排版写作:按照逻辑顺序,依次撰写文章的各个部分,确保表达清晰、流畅。三、操作流程
1. 预备工作:清楚了解答辩的时间和地点,准备所需的工具和资料。
2. 开篇亮点:在开篇部分,可以引用一句有趣的语言或者提出引人入胜的问题,引起读者的兴趣。
3. 问题分析:对于答辩题目中的关键词进行分析,明确各个关键词的含义和关联,从而能够准确把握答辩的重点。
4. 内容展开:从宏观上分析问题,再逐步展开到细节方面的论述,确保文章层次清晰,逻辑连贯。
5. 解决方案:根据问题的分析和论证,提出切实可行的解决方案,说明其优势和可行性。
6. 结尾总结:在文章的结尾,对整个答辩过程进行总结,强调答辩的亮点和创新之处。四、结构清晰
1. 标题的使用:根据文章的逻辑结构和内容,合理使用小标题,使文章更容易阅读和理解。
2. 段落的分段:每段之间用空行进行分隔,使文章的结构更加清晰。
3. 逻辑的衔接:每个段落之间要有明确的逻辑关系,确保文章的思路清晰、连续。
4. 重点突出:通过字体加粗、下划线、颜色等方式,突出文章中的重点内容。综上所述,一篇高质量的PHP答辩文章应该从方法、操作流程等方面展开讲解。文章字数要大于3000字,内容结构清晰,结合小标题展示。通过合理的方法和清晰的操作流程,以及适当的结构安排,读者能够写出一篇引人入胜的PHP答辩文章。
2年前